This study aims to use white matter tract integrity (WMTI) model based on DKI to explore white matter alternations in T2DM. DTI and WMTI metrics were compared between 73 T2DM patients and 57 HCs. The widespread increased extra-axonal diffusivity with limited increased intra-axonal diffusivity in T2DM reflected different degrees of axonal edema, vasogenic edema and/or demyelination. De,⊥ (radial extra-axonal diffusivity) was demonstrated to be the most sensitive parameter in detecting the white matter microstructural changes. De,⊥ in genu of the corpus callosum was correlated with attention performance, which is expected to be a imaging marker reflecting cognitive impairment in T2DM.
